Comprehending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ters are electrically powered gadgets developed for individuals with minimal mobility. They provide a way of transportation for individuals who may have problem walking but still want to retain their independence. They are available in different styles and features to accommodate a wide variety of needs.
Types of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ters can normally be categorized into three primary types:
Type
Description
Best For
Compact Scooters
These are small and lightweight, ideal for indoors and short trips.
Users with limited storage area or those who take a trip frequently.
Mid-size Scooters
A balance in between mobility and stability, appropriate for both indoor and outside usage.
Those who need to cover a range of surfaces.
Durable Scooters
Big and robust, designed for rugged outside usage and heavier people.
Users requiring extra weight capacity or going off-road.
Key Features of Mobility Scooters
The option of mobility scooter typically depends upon the features that line up with specific requirements. Here are a few of the essential features to think about:
Weight Capacity: Mobility scooters come with various weight limitations. It is vital to choose a scooter that can sufficiently support the user's weight.
Range: The distance a scooter can take a trip on a single charge varies. Depending on user requirements, one might select scooters with a variety of approximately 40 miles.
Speed: Most mobility scooters can reach speeds between 4 to 8 mph. Consider what speed is comfy and safe for the desired environment.
Turning Radius: A compact turning radius is vital for indoor use, enabling simpler navigation in tight areas.
Battery Type: The type of batteries utilized can impact the scooter's performance. Lead-acid and lithium-ion batteries are the most typical.

Crucial Considerations When Buying a Mobility Scooter
When purchasing a mobility scooter, numerous factors to consider can help make sure that you select the right model:
Assess Individual Needs:
- Mobility level: Consider how much support the person will require.
- Series of usage: Determine where the scooter will mainly be used (inside, outdoors, on rough surfaces, etc).
Test Drive:
- Always test drive numerous designs to find a suitable fit. Focus on comfort, ease of steering, and the scooter's responsiveness.
Evaluation Safety Features:
- Look for scooters with sufficient security functions like lights, indications, and anti-tip designs.
Inspect Warranty and Service Options:
- A reliable service warranty and offered service choices are essential for long-term use.
